How much do audio visual project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for audio visual project manager in Delray Beach, FL is $82,326.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$57,700.00 and $101,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an audio visual project manager do?

The responsibilities of an audiovisual (AV) project manager include supervising all personnel and activities related to audiovisual installation, construction, financing, scheduling, coordinating required resources, and collecting materials for an event. In this career, you are also responsible for ensuring a perfect execution while staying within the budget. You consult with clients on event details, maintain the contract, and ensure client satisfaction. Other duties include coordinating installation, programming equipment, testing, and troubleshooting. You are the primary person for all internal and external communications and documentation. You provide progress reports to the necessary parties or individuals at various points throughout the project. As an audio visual project manager, you travel and support event production at various venues including hotels, schools, and convention centers.

What is an audio visual project manager?

Audio Visual (AV) Project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the planning, coordination, and execution of audio visual projects, such as installing AV systems in offices, schools, or event venues. They manage teams, budgets, timelines, and client communications to ensure projects are completed successfully and meet client expectations. These managers often coordinate with vendors, technicians, and other stakeholders to ensure all technical requirements are met and that installations run smoothly. Their expertise is crucial in delivering high-quality AV solutions on time and within budget.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an audio visual project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Audio Visual Project Manager, you need strong project management skills, technical knowledge of AV systems, and experience with budgeting and scheduling, often supported by a degree in a related field or PMP certification. Familiarity with AV design software, control systems (like Crestron or Extron), and project management tools such as MS Project or Smartsheet is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and leadership skills help in coordinating teams and managing client expectations. These qualifications ensure projects are completed on time, within budget, and to the technical standards required by clients.

What is the difference between Audio Visual Project Manager vs AV Technician?

AspectAudio Visual Project ManagerAV Technician
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or’s degree in AV technology, engineering, or related field; certifications like CTS are commonOften has technical certifications or vocational training; may not require a degree
Work EnvironmentManages multiple projects, coordinates teams, and liaises with clients in corporate, event, or conference settingsPerforms hands-on installation, troubleshooting, and maintenance of AV equipment on-site
Employer & IndustryEmployed by AV integrators, event companies, or corporate AV departmentsWorks for AV service providers, event venues, or as freelance technicians

The main difference is that an Audio Visual Project Manager oversees entire AV projects, focusing on planning, coordination, and client communication, while an AV Technician handles the technical installation and maintenance of AV equipment. Both roles are essential in the AV industry but serve different functions within project execution.

What are some common challenges audio visual project managers face when coordinating installations across multiple sites?

Audio Visual Project Managers frequently encounter challenges such as managing tight timelines, ensuring equipment availability, and coordinating with various vendors and on-site teams across different locations. Effective communication and meticulous planning are crucial to address unexpected site-specific issues, such as infrastructure limitations or last-minute changes in client requirements. Additionally, aligning all stakeholders—including clients, technicians, and subcontractors—requires strong organizational skills to keep projects on schedule and within budget.
